Background: The Evolution of Online Gambling in the UK
The history of gambling in the UK dates back centuries, but it was only with advancements in technology that online platforms gained significant traction. Following the Gambling Act of 2005, which regulated remote gambling activities, there has been a surge in participation rates among various demographics. What once was seen as taboo is now embraced by millions as an enjoyable form of entertainment.
Today’s players are diverse; they range from seasoned gamblers to newcomers wanting to try their luck from the comfort of their homes. With a plethora of options available—ranging from sports betting to casino games—understanding what drives these players can provide valuable insights into regional habits.

The Pros and Cons of Online Gambling in the UK
- Pros:
- Diverse gaming options cater to varying preferences.
- The convenience of playing from anywhere at any time.
- Anonymity compared to traditional casinos might appeal to some players.
- Cons:
- The risk of developing gambling addiction without proper self-control measures.
- Potential for misleading advertising tactics from unscrupulous operators.
- The challenge of navigating regulations can overwhelm new players.
